Hollywood Talent Joins Namit Malhotra's Ramayana

A Cinematic Marvel in the Making

Namit Malhotra’s 'Ramayana' is set to become a landmark in Indian cinema. This ambitious project aims to retell the classic epic with a vision and scale that promises to captivate audiences worldwide. 🎬✨ Imagine a saga that combines the timeless narrative of Ramayana with cutting-edge visual storytelling and you begin to grasp the magnitude of this endeavor.

Star-Studded Cast and Crew

Headlining the cast are some of Bollywood's finest: Ranbir Kapoor as Lord Ram, Sai Pallavi as Sita, Yash as the formidable Ravana, and Sunny Deol portraying Hanuman. These actors are joined by Ravi Dubey, who will play Lakshman, enhancing the film's appeal to a diverse audience.

However, what truly sets this project apart is the involvement of international talent behind the scenes. The film has enlisted the expertise of Hollywood legends Terry Notary and Guy Norris. Notary, renowned for his motion capture expertise in 'Planet of the Apes', and Norris, celebrated for his work on 'Mad Max: Fury Road', are set to elevate the action sequences to unparalleled heights. 🔥

A Global Cinematic Experience

The decision to bring in such acclaimed talent underscores the filmmakers' commitment to crafting a global spectacle. Namit Malhotra's Prime Focus Studios, in collaboration with 8-time Oscar-winning DNEG and Yash's Monster Mind Creations, is pulling out all stops to ensure that 'Ramayana' becomes a visual and emotional masterpiece.

The film will be released in two parts, with Part 1 scheduled for Diwali 2026 and Part 2 for Diwali 2027, exclusively in IMAX theaters.
